The IT Application Support Analyst supports the continued development and maintenance of the web application for EdAssist clients. This role will perform second level application troubleshooting, issue resolution and root cause analysis and will assist in technical implementation of new clients.
This is a part time, Remote position available in the United States, working 20 hours a week.

Compensation:
The expected FTE salary is $74,000, Part time salary is $37,000. The pay range listed here is what Bright Horizons in good faith anticipates offering for this job opening. Actual compensation offers within this range will depend on a variety of factors including experience, education and training, certifications, geography, and other relevant business or organizational factors.
